Mental Health Assessments
A mental health evaluation is a series of questions regarding your mood and thinking. You could also be asked for a physical examination and verbal or written tests.
The first part of the mental status exam is evaluating the patient's appearance and general behavior, level of awareness and attention motor activity, speech, and the content of their thoughts.
Screening tools
The use of screening tools is a crucial aspect of an assessment of mental health. The tools are designed for doctors to determine the existence of certain diseases. This can help them determine the best treatment option. They also aid clinicians to focus on areas for further investigation or testing. A patient could be suffering from depression, but the condition may not be severe enough to warrant a complete diagnostic evaluation. The screening tool can highlight this possibility and guide the patient to a complete mental health examination.
As a complement to screening tools, clinicians may also use questionnaires or structured interviews to begin their assessments. General questions regarding the patient's mood and feelings as well as their daily routine and thought patterns, can reveal initial concerns. In addition, clinicians can note the physical appearance of the patient as well as their capacity to function normally, which could indicate the presence of underlying issues.
It is crucial to take into account the patient's history and needs when determining a mental health assessment pathway. A person with a past of abuse or trauma is more likely to openly discuss their symptoms. In these instances it is best to ask questions in a nonjudgmental manner and offer supportive responses.
Another key aspect of a successful mental health assessment is determining the level of stigma associated with specific conditions. For instance there are many who are hesitant to seek out mental health services because they fear rejection or embarrassment. Clients might also be subject to discrimination from family members or friends who have a negative perception of mental illness. This can result in a lack of trust that makes it difficult to establish therapeutic connections. In this situation the worksheet can be useful in helping patients to understand the stigmas associated with mental illness and ways to overcome the stigma.
Additionally, doctors can utilize screening tools to identify potential risk factors for specific disorders. These symptoms can be those that are typically associated with a particular condition, such as sleeplessness or changes in eating habits or muscles tension, or appetite. The GHQ-2, for example, is a self report screening tool that will determine if a patient's symptoms last longer than expected or are temporary.
Rating scales
A mental health assessment is a review of your symptoms by an experienced medical or mental health professional. It can be conducted in person via phone or online and is designed to assist doctors determine the best treatment plan for your specific condition. It will also determine which of the various options of care is most appropriate to the severity of your symptoms. These include hospitalization, intensive outpatient or outpatient therapy. A psychiatric assessment will also evaluate your family and personal history.
An interview is the first step of a psychiatric evaluation. This will allow you to discover more information about your symptoms. A variety of tests are available to determine whether you suffer from any specific disorder. A personality test, for instance can reveal how you react to stressful situations or other factors that may contribute to mental health issues. It can also be used to determine the severity of your symptoms and if they affect your daily routine.
Rating scales are useful tools that can be used in conjunction with a diagnostic interview or as standalone measures. There are many kinds of assessment tools that are standardized, and it is important to understand how they work. The Columbia Depression Scale, for instance is a self-report measurement of 22 items which can test teens for suicidal and depression-related thoughts. It is simple to use and takes just 15 minutes.
Psychologists can also use behavioral tests to gather more detailed information about a patient's behaviour. These can be used to assess the cognitive abilities of a patient, such as the ability to concentrate or recall, as well as their social abilities. A therapist will then utilize the information to create an treatment plan that is best suited to the individual's needs. The therapist will then recommend an appropriate treatment program for the patient based on the results of this assessment. This could include talk therapy or medication.
Assessment questionnaires
Assessment questionnaires are an important element of mental health assessments. They can be used to evaluate a patient's cognitive functioning, as well as their emotional or physical state. They can also be used to assess how a patient is responding to treatment. A mental health exam could also include a look at the patient's behavior and appearance. This information can be helpful in identifying conditions such as depression or neurological conditions like Alzheimer's disease. It can also be used to determine addiction to alcohol or drugs.
The first step of an assessment of mental health is to gather data regarding the client's symptoms as well as previous history. A mental health evaluation may also include a short standard test, like the Mini-mental State Examination (MMSE). This instrument measures an individual's ability to think and recall. It can also be used to determine if the person has a mental illness.
An assessment can also include the Cultural Formulation Interview (CFI) or supplementary modules that allow clinicians to gather additional collateral information about a person's culture. These questionnaires inquire about the patient's family and their community as well as their culture-specific beliefs and values. These tools can help determine the way in which a person's cultural background affects their presentation and treatment.
While mental health assessments are usually performed by a psychologist or psychiatrist, they can also be conducted by other healthcare professionals. A primary physician, for instance could use a psychological assessment to determine if a patient is suffering from mental health issues. A psychiatric social worker or nurse may also perform a psychological assessment on patients.
During a mental health assessment the clinician may also use questionnaires to check for specific symptoms and to determine how severe they are. These are usually tests that require the person taking them to rate a particular sign on a scale from one to 10. Some of these quizzes come with an added feature that lets users note the severity of their symptoms.
Checklists
Mental health professionals use mental health assessments in a similar way to doctors who use radiographs and blood tests to discern the medical signs of a patient. These tests can help determine the cause of emotional distress in a patient, and help develop a more effective treatment plan.
These mental health assessments comprise of questionnaires and interviews. They may also include observation and specialized tests. For example, a personality test may include the Minnesota Multiphasic Personality Inventory (MMPI). These tools can assist doctors gain insight into a person's mental state and determine the most effective course of action for treatment.
In the initial interview, mental health professionals will ask patients questions about their symptoms and concerns. They will also ask questions about their lifestyle, previous psychotherapy and psychiatric treatment, family history, and prior psychotherapy or psychiatric treatment. They should also be aware of the medications they are taking, including prescription and over-the-counter drugs. It is crucial to rule these out because physical illnesses can mimic symptoms of mental illness.
Psychologists can also perform cognitive tests to assess a patient's ability to think clearly and solve problems. These tests could include tests of spatial ability, memory, and concentration. These assessments can include IQ tests that test a person’s ability to communicate and learn information.
Children can also be screened for mental health. The specific screening measures are dependent on the child's ages and could include a series of questions about their feelings and behaviour. Certain children may also be asked to complete an assessment form, like the Checklist of Suspected Depression or Anxiety. This tool allows children to choose the boxes that best express the way they feel.
These assessments can aid a doctor in diagnosing and treat a number of mental disorders, such as mood disorders such as anxiety and depression. They can also assist in identifying eating disorders such as anorexia and bulimia, and att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D). These assessments can assist a doctor to determine whether a patient has to be hospitalized or if they require counseling or medication.
